About the Arsenal Poster
Arsenal is Gunners' territory — the Piccadilly line station renamed after the football club, the only tube stop in London named for a sports team. The Emirates Stadium's sixty-thousand-seat bowl dominates the surrounding residential streets of Highbury, and the Arsenal Heritage museum preserves the club's history from Woolwich to Highbury to the Ashburton Grove site. On match days the streets fill with red-and-white shirts; on quiet days the neighbourhood reverts to a calm North London residential quarter of Victorian terraces and tree-lined avenues. Where is Arsenal station?
Arsenal is on the Piccadilly line in zone 2, North London — the only tube station named after a football club. It serves the Emirates Stadium, Arsenal's 60,000-seat home ground.
